Determine which windsurfer is traveling faster. Explain your reasoning.
Windsurfer #1:Speed: 5 meters per second. Windsurfer #2:Speed: 720 feet per minute.

Windsurfer #1 because it goes 16.4 feet per second and #2 only goes 12 feet per second
